Official Rule Breakdown

In Pandemic, players lose the game if any of three specific conditions are met. Regarding the outbreak limit, the game ends and the team loses if the outbreaks marker reaches the last space of the Outbreaks Track. This is distinct from the other two losing conditions: being unable to place the required number of disease cubes due to insufficient supply, or being unable to draw two Player cards when required. Example Play Situation

Alice draws an Infection card that causes an outbreak in Paris. She moves the outbreaks marker forward one space on the track. If that movement lands the marker on the very last space of the track, the game ends immediately and Alice's team loses.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the official rule for outbreaks in Pandemic?
An outbreak occurs when a city has 3 cubes and a new one is added; move the marker forward 1 space.
How many outbreaks can happen before I lose?
The game ends when the outbreaks marker reaches the final space on the Outbreaks Track.
Does the game end if a city gets 4 cubes?
No, a city with 3 cubes triggers an outbreak, but you only lose if the global outbreak marker hits the end.
What happens if I can't place enough cubes on the board?
If there are not enough cubes in the supply to meet the requirement, your team loses immediately.
